如何在CKAN中显示寄存器

时间:2015-08-06 15:29:28

标签: ckan

我的注册有问题,我看不到在主页面登录旁边的注册消失了,

如果我想访问/ user / register页面,它会将我重定向到这个URL:

http://www.example.com/user/login?came_from=http://www.example.com
/user/register

这是development.ini配置:

ckan.auth.anon_create_dataset = false
ckan.auth.create_unowned_dataset = false
ckan.auth.create_dataset_if_not_in_organization = false
ckan.auth.user_create_groups = true
ckan.auth.user_create_organizations = true
ckan.auth.user_delete_groups = true
ckan.auth.user_delete_organizations = true
ckan.auth.create_user_via_api = true
ckan.auth.create_user_via_web = true
ckan.auth.roles_that_cascade_to_sub_groups = admin

如果您可以看到ckan.auth.create_user_via_webtrue

我该怎么做才能克服这个问题?

1 个答案:

答案 0 :(得分:0)

"注册"如果auth函数user_create为True,则显示链接,这取决于我认为您具有True的配置选项create_user_via_web。因此,我非常确定Ross的评论是正确的,您需要重新启动CKAN(即apache或paster)才能使更新配置生效。